Course Description

Self-study. Using the Microphone (mic) Looper for music making and clinical music therapy work. This course will provide mic looper instruction focusing on using this recording device for spontaneous recording/layering of instrument and vocal music parts.

The course is presented as video based lectures that require you to watch the individual lessons, practice what is being taught then take a post test at the end of the course for final evaluation.

*** Is owning a microphone looper required before taking the course?

No, the course can be taken and trying many of the discussed examples can be done using a cell phone voice recorder, iPad or tablet voice recorder or by recording layered parts using computer based DAW applications like Garageband, Ableton Live, ProTools, etc.

***Why then is a looper device used if recording can be done on the devices described above?

Layering of more than one part is not possible on phone/tablet voice recorders and computer based DAW applications are not as portable and are much more expensive. Also, computer based DAW applications are not practical for live music making. But the biggest reasons why the Mic Looper is outstanding is because it is so portable and it allows for “on the spot,” spontaneous layering of parts. Perfect for live music making for performers and music therapists. Go to YouTube and watch professional musicians use loopers in their performances.

Learning Objectives (relevant CBMT scope and practice items)

By the end of the course instruction participants will be able to (***or begin to):

(II-D-12, III-A-5) demonstrate how to connect a microphone looper to a speaker system.

(II-D, III-A-2, III-A-4-a, III-A-4-g, III-A-5) apply demonstrated mic looper techniques and examples to clinical music therapy work.

(III-A-1, III-A-5-e, III-A-5-f, III-A-5-g, III-A-5-i, III-A-5-hh) design various vocal music experiences using the mic looper.

(II-D, III-A-1, III-A-5) engage in various music instrument experiences using the mic looper.
